In article number 1900013 Panagiotis Grammatikopoulos, Mukhles Sowwan, and Joseph Kioseoglou provide a comprehensive review on the fundamental mechanisms and simulation tools of nanoparticle coalescence. Numerous case studies are presented of various materials and potential applications, including aerosol fabrication, neuromorphic computation, and nanoparticle‐support interaction as an extreme case of coalescence; also, the essence of coalescence is clarified by contrasting it to soft agglomeration.
